| The best cities for young professionalsIf you're a recent graduate looking to jump-start your career, New York City isn't the only destination you should consider. By Matt Woolsey, Forbes.comHead to the Big Apple, and your chances of getting the corner office might not be as far off as you think. That's because New York City tops the Forbes list as the No. 1 city for young professionals. That likely comes as a shock to, well, no one. Many of America's best companies, as determined by Forbes' rankings of the best 400 big businesses and best 200 small businesses, including financial giant Goldman Sachs and media conglomerate News Corp., are in New York. Throw in New York's bars, clubs and world-class dining, and you get a city teeming with young professionals. San Francisco clocked in at No. 2 and Atlanta at No. 3. Los Angeles, Washington, D.C., Boston and Seattle filled spots four through seven, and Minneapolis, Philadelphia and Denver closed out the top 10. Behind the numbers The list was compiled by tracking where the graduates of top universities across the country ended up 10 years after commencement, where the best business opportunities exist, which cities had the most young and unmarried people, and which cities paid young professionals the best. | | |
